The tip of the pseudopilus
Article by Korotkov and Hol

The bacterial type 2 secretion system (T2SS) exports proteins across the outer membrane. The T2SS includes the pseudopilus, a structure formed by a major pseudopilin protein and a few minor ones. The crystal structure of a complex formed by three minor pseudopilins from E. coli now indicates their localization and function in the pseudopilus.

ATP-dependent chromatin remodelers disrupt histone-DNA contacts and have been implicated in many nuclear processes. Genome-wide analysis of replication progression and other data now indicate that two yeast remodeling complexes, Ino80 and Isw2, work in parallel to promote replication fork progression.

While it is known that phosphorylation is key to spliceosomal assembly, the targets and mechanistic basis of this has been unclear. The SRPK2 kinase is here shown to target PRP28, thus stabilizing its association with the tri-snRNP and promoting tri-snRNP integration into the spliceosome.

Cap-binding by influenza
Article by Cusack and colleagues

Influenza virus "snatches" the 5'cap from host pre-mRNAs to prime viral transcription. A domain in viral polymerase PB2 with cap-binding activity is now identified, and its crystal structure bound to a cap analog is solved.

Ras activation depends on its interaction with SOS. Data now show that when Ras is membrane-bound, the activity of the SOS catalytic unit is up to 500-fold higher than rates in solution. Further analyses indicate how membrane recruitment of SOS through Ras and PIP2 work cooperatively to control SOS activity.

Nuclear actin related proteins (ARPs) associate with a subset of chromatin remodeling and modification complexes. Here HSA domains are found to provide a conserved platform for specifically recruiting the set of ARPs or actin peculiar to a given remodeler or modification complex.
